Every measurement provides three kinds of information: the size or magnitude of the measurement (a number), a standard of comparison for the measurement (a unit), and an indication of the uncertainty of the measurement. While the number and unit are explicitly represented when a quantity is written, the uncertainty is an aspect of the errors in the measurement results.

A schema is a mental construct consisting of a cluster or collection of related concepts (Bartlett, 1932). There are many different types of schemata, and they all have one thing in common: schemata are a method of organizing information that allows the brain to work more efficiently. When a schema is activated, the brain makes immediate assumptions about the person or object being observed.

Evolution shapes the features of organisms over time, ensuring that they are suited for the environments in which they live. Sometimes, selection pressure leads to the rise of similar but unrelated adaptations in organisms with no recent common ancestors, a process known as convergent evolution.

Handmade Traction Wrist Tower.

Alexander Zolotov1

  • 1Department of Orthopedic Surgery, Medical Center, Far Eastern Federal University, Vladivostok, Russia.

Journal of Wrist Surgery
|October 24, 2018
PubMed
Summary

This study introduces a handmade wrist traction device made from improvised materials as an affordable alternative to commercial options. The device is effective for wrist arthroscopy and other surgical procedures requiring traction.

Area of Science:

  • Orthopedic surgery
  • Biomedical engineering
  • Medical device innovation

Background:

  • Expensive branded traction devices pose a barrier to certain surgical procedures.
  • The need for cost-effective surgical aids in orthopedic interventions.
  • Limited availability of accessible traction solutions for wrist surgeries.

Purpose of the Study:

  • To present a novel, handmade traction wrist tower constructed from readily available materials.
  • To evaluate the efficacy of this improvised device as a substitute for commercial traction systems.
  • To demonstrate its utility in wrist joint arthroscopy and other forearm surgical procedures.

Main Methods:

  • Construction of a functional wrist traction device using improvised materials.
  • Application of the device in simulated or actual surgical scenarios requiring wrist traction.
